The ETAP 21i is a safe, comfortable and fast family sailing yacht sleeping up to four in an open plan layout.  This particular example is the tandem keel version and is powered by a Honda 8hp 4 stroke outboard. She has benefited from a number of upgrades including new mast, standing and running rigging in 2014, ultrasonic antifouling, a bowsprit and more and is offered for sale with a braked, single axle road trailer.

Accommodation

The accommodation offers up to four berths in an open plan layout.

Companionway with sliding hatch leading to saloon, settee berths to port and starboard sides with storage above and below.  Galley to port with moulded sink unit and cold pumped water supply, Origo 3000 two burner spirit stove and storage cupboard beneath.  Double berth to forepeak with Par marine toilet to port, infill cushion and escape hatch above to foredeck.

Sails, Spars and Rigging

Masthead rigged sloop.  Silver anodised aluminium mast and boom (mast and rigging replaced by Z Spars in 2014). Spinnaker pole. Stainless steel standing rigging (2014). Terylene running rigging (2023). Slab reefing to mainsail. Lazyjacks. Kicker tang. Furlex 100S furling genoa. All lines led aft to cockpit.

Mainsail - Dacron - Elvstrom 

Genoa - Dacron - Elvstrom (2014)

A Symmetric - Nylon - Contender - Elvstrom (2014)

Spinnaker - Age unknown

Construction

Built by ETAP in 1998 to a design by Mortain and Mavrikios. White GRP hull and superstructure with red style lines. Moulded in non slip to decks and self draining cockpit. Tandem keel. Tiller steering to transom hung rudders. Ultrasonic antifouling (2011)
